Lecturer Positions in Computer Science University of California at Davis Department of Computer Science
Lecturer Positions 2017-2018
Open date: November 30th, 2016
The Department of Computer Science seeks to hire 1-2 Temporary Lecturers to teach undergraduate courses during Academic Year 2017-2018. These positions are dependent upon the instructional needs of the department and may be full or part-time.
Candidates must have a Bachelor’s degree, or preferably a PhD, in Computer Science or a closely related field, be committed to excellence in teaching, and have demonstrated instructional experience. We expect the candidate to be able to teach most of the courses in the undergraduate computer science engineering curriculum and possibly selected graduate courses. The candidates will also have the opportunity to lead undergraduate student research projects (190/192/199 units) and develop newer seminars/courses with broad appeal in areas that influence computer science and engineering education.
